Package io.ocfl.core.validation.model
Class SimpleVersion
java.lang.Object
io.ocfl.core.validation.model.SimpleVersion
A minimally structured representation of an OCFL version
-
Field Summary
Fields -
Constructor Summary
ConstructorsConstructorDescriptionSimpleVersion
(String created, String message, SimpleUser user, Map<String, List<String>> state) -
Method Summary
Modifier and TypeMethodDescriptionboolean
getState()
getUser()
int
hashCode()
setCreated
(String created) setMessage
(String message) setUser
(SimpleUser user) toString()
-
Field Details
-
CREATED_KEY
- See Also:
-
MESSAGE_KEY
- See Also:
-
USER_KEY
- See Also:
-
STATE_KEY
- See Also:
-
-
Constructor Details
-
SimpleVersion
public SimpleVersion() -
SimpleVersion
-
-
Method Details
-
getCreated
-
setCreated
-
getMessage
-
setMessage
-
getUser
-
setUser
-
getState
-
setState
-
getInvertedState
- Returns:
- the inverted state map -- should NOT be modified
-
toString
-
equals
-
hashCode
public int hashCode()
-